Mayo Clinic experts describe how radiation works to treat brain tumors. Visit https://mayocl.in/2m7jlnG to request an appointment or learn more about brain tumor treatment at Mayo Clinic.Radiation therapy has a prominent role in treating primary and metastatic brain tumors. Radiation application depends on the type of tumor and works by damaging DNA within the tumor's cells.
Intensity-modulated radiation therapy (IMRT) is an advanced type of radiation therapy used to treat cancer and noncancerous tumors. IMRT uses advanced technology to manipulate photon and proton beams of radiation to conform to the shape of a tumor.
Mayo Clinic is working on new types of treatment options for brain tumors, including cutting-edge radiation and chemotherapies.
